You can use VNC program that works on port 5900
All you need to do is make sure that Listener (vnc server) is installed and then Add rule to your incoming host computer firewall to allow vnc.exe software go through port 5900

if the device you want to remotely administered is on another private or public network most likely you'll be using the internet as a mean to access it. Wifi is just the medium or technology , just like Ethernet, you use. If you are in a test environment testing connecting to other devices you can use vnc,  microsoft remote desktop connection (if you're using microsoft OS that supports it).  The same technologies can used in an "internet environment" but there could be more configuration to be done if the device you want to connect is behind a firewall or router.   For easy remote administration you can think of teamviewer, it seems to me you want to know how things work when it comes to vpn and ports so make sure you go over the basic networking concepts and as you are trying to do: practice, practice, practice..
